
Việt Lê’s creative and critical practice as a queer, disabled artist focuses on sexualities, spiritualities–the physical and the metaphysical. Focused on global south indigenous shamanisms and knowledge traditions, Dr. Lê’s non-profit foundation SEA sạ seeks to share resources and wisdom among artists, healers, researchers and healers. Việt Lê is the author of Return Engagements: (Duke University Press, 2021, which received the 2023 Outstanding Book Award from the Association of Asian American Studies), and collaborated with Latipa on the art book White Gaze (Sming Sming Books | Candor Art, 2019, second edition). Việt Lê is Professor Emeritus/a at California College of the Arts. A 2022-24 Headlands Bay Area Fellow and ‘22 Stanford CCSRE Mellon Arts Fellow, Lê’s recent solo shows include đến đền đến (Sàn Art | Sài Gòn 2025),thương (w/ artist and poet Ly Hoàng Ly: Armory Gallery, Virginia Tech; UVA Chapel, University of Virginia, 2025), Việt Namaste (Headlands Center for the Arts, 2024) and an upcoming residency and solo show at Artpace San Antonio (2026).
